Enabling codecs
In Element Manager, select the codecs that will be enabledfor calls on the
Call Server, and define the associated parameters, such as payload size.
Select the Nodes: Servers, Media Cards web page under IP Network.
Then click Edit on the Node Configuration web page, and click VGWand
IP phone codec profile. Select an existing codec or configure a new
one in the VGW and IP phone codec profile section, shown in Figure 13
"Configuring a codec" (page 64). Refer to IP Peer Networking: Installation
and Configuration (NN43001-313) for full instructions on configuring a
codec.
